Mentor

Every first-year student is assigned to a mentor group, led by a senior student of the programme. Your mentor is there to help you adjust to life at university and your programme in particular, with (group) mentor meetings, individual talks and social activities. Your mentor is the first point of contact while you get settled. During the first half year of the programme there will be several meetings where you can ask them anything.


Mentor Groups Biology

Within the bachelor of Biology, you will get to know your mentor (=senior student of biology) in the very beginning of the introduction day. You will stay within your mentor group of approximately 14 other first year students throughout the entire day. This way, you are hopefully not too intimidated by large lecture halls full of students. 

In the last week of August, you will receive an email with information about who your mentor is and how to contact them with any questions you may already have - either about the introduction day, or about officially starting our programme in September .

Mentor meetings

It hasn’t been that long since the mentors were first year students themselves, so they know from their own experience what it was like to be new in the programme, new at university, new in Groningen, new in the Netherlands. Your mentor will be there to help and guide you during these first exciting months.

Your group will meet (at least) 6 to 7 times during the first semester. The meetings will take place in person on campus. Several topics will be dealt with, like getting to know your fellow students, where to find all the information you need and how to get around on campus. Later in the semester, you will get tips & tricks to improve your study skills, make choices in your programme, plan & prepare for exams etc. You can ALWAYS contact your mentor – in these meetings but also at other moments – if you have worries or questions about your study or other issues.
